The Evolving Costs of Home Solar Systems

The cost of installing a solar system in your home has been steadily decreasing over the past decade, thanks to technological advancements and increased competition within the market. By 2026, these costs are expected to become even more affordable for the average Australian household.

Initial Installation Costs

While the initial outlay for a solar system can be significant, prices have dropped substantially. The average cost of a 5kW solar power system, suitable for a typical Australian home, ranges from $5,000 to $8,000 as of 2023. By 2026, due to further advancements and reductions in manufacturing costs, these prices are projected to decrease slightly, making solar an even more enticing option for homeowners.

Solar Incentives in Australia

Government incentives have been crucial in bolstering the adoption of solar energy across Australia. These incentives reduce the financial burden on homeowners, making the switch to solar more accessible.

Federal Government Incentives

The federal government offers the Small-scale Renewable Energy Scheme (SRES), which provides financial incentives for the installation of eligible small-scale renewable energy systems. This includes solar panels, wind, and hydro systems. The scheme issues Small-scale Technology Certificates (STCs), which can be sold to offset the upfront cost of installation. State-Based Rebates and Schemes

In addition to federal incentives, various state governments offer additional rebates and incentives to encourage solar adoption. For instance, the Victorian Solar Homes Program provides rebates for solar panel systems, battery storage, and even solar hot water systems. Similar programs are anticipated to continue, with potential expansions in scope and value by 2026.

Local Council Initiatives

Some local councils provide additional support through grants and low-interest loans for solar installations. These initiatives aim to encourage local residents to switch to solar, thereby promoting community-wide adoption of renewable energy sources.

Return on Investment (ROI) for Home Solar

Investing in solar energy offers significant long-term financial benefits. Understanding the ROI for home solar systems is crucial for homeowners considering this investment.

Long-Term Savings

One of the most compelling reasons to install solar panels is the potential for long-term savings on energy bills. By generating your own electricity, you can significantly reduce or even eliminate your monthly electricity expenses. With rising energy costs, these savings are expected to increase, enhancing the solar ROI for homeowners.

Increased Property Value

Homes equipped with solar panels often have higher property values. As energy efficiency becomes a priority for homebuyers, properties with solar installations become more attractive. This trend is expected to continue, making solar a wise investment for those looking to increase their home’s market value.

Technological Advances and Future Trends

The solar industry is dynamic, with continuous advancements that promise to shape its future. By 2026, several technological trends are expected to impact the solar market.

Improved Solar Panel Efficiency

The efficiency of solar panels is a critical factor in maximizing energy production. Innovations in photovoltaic technology are expected to increase the efficiency of solar panels, allowing homeowners to generate more energy from smaller installations.

Integration with Battery and Hybrid Systems

Combining solar panels with battery and hybrid systems allows homeowners to store excess energy for use when the sun isn’t shining. This integration can enhance energy independence and ensure a consistent power supply, even during outages or at night.

Smart Home Integration

The rise of smart technology is influencing the way solar systems are managed. By 2026, more solar systems are expected to integrate with smart home technologies, allowing homeowners to monitor and optimize their energy usage through apps and other digital platforms.
